Preheat and Prepare: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Line a muffin tin with paper liners or grease each cup lightly.
Mix Dry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, salt, cinnamon, and nutmeg.
Combine Wet Ingredients: In a separate bowl, whisk together the melted butter, eggs, buttermilk, vanilla extract, and orange zest until well combined.
Combine Wet and Dry Ingredients: Add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ients, stirring until just combined. Be careful not to overmix; a few lumps are okay. Fold in the chopped cranberries gently.
Fill Muffin Cups: Divide the batter evenly among the muffin cups, filling each about two-thirds full.
Bake: Bake in the preheated oven for 18-20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. The tops should be golden brown.
Prepare the Glaze: While the muffins are baking, whisk together the powdered sugar, orange juice, and orange zest until smooth. Adjust the consistency by adding more juice or sugar as needed.
Glaze the Muffins: Once the muffins are out of the oven and have cooled for a few minutes, drizzle the glaze over the tops. Allow the glaze to set before serving.
